Section 2: How to Get a Flat World in Minecraft PE

Minecraft PE is the mobile version of the game and is available on both Android and iOS devices. Here is how to get a flat world in Minecraft PE:

Step 1: Open Minecraft PE and tap on “New” to create a new world.

Step 2: Name your world and select “Create.”

Step 3: Swipe left to reveal the “Game Settings” tab.

Step 4: Scroll down to “World Type” and select “Flat.”

Step 5: Customize the world by selecting the “Customize” button. You can adjust layers and other settings.

Step 6: Select “Create World,” and you’re ready to go!

Section 3: How to Make a Flat World in Minecraft Java Edition

Minecraft Java Edition is the PC version of the game and is available on Windows, Mac, and Linux. Here is how to make a flat world in Minecraft Java Edition:

Step 1: Launch Minecraft Java Edition and click on “Create New World.”

Step 2: Name your world and select “Create World.”

Step 3: Click on “More World Options.”

Step 4: Scroll down to “World Type” and select “Customized.”

Step 5: Click on “Customize” to reveal the customization menu.

Step 6: Under “Presets,” select “Flat.”

Step 7: Customize the world by adjusting layers, adding villages or playing around with other settings.

Step 8: Click on “Done” to save and generate the world.

Section 4: How to Make a Flat World in Minecraft PS4

Minecraft PS4 is the console version of the game and is available on PlayStation 4. Here is how to make a flat world in Minecraft PS4:

Step 1: Load Minecraft PS4 and click on “Play Game.”

Step 2: Click on “Create New World.”

Step 3: Name your world and select “Create.”

Step 4: Click on “Edit.”

Step 5: Scroll and select “Flat.”

Step 6: Customize the world options as needed.

Step 7: Click on “Create.”
